Background technique
Autoclaved lightweight aerated concrete partition plate, abbreviation ALC(Autoclavd Lightweight Concrete) plate, tool
There are the advantages such as lightweight, fire protecting performance and sound insulation value are good, environmentally protective, economic, construction is convenient.
Existing autoclaved lightweight sand aerated concrete plate in process, usually adds autoclaved lightweight sand using slitter
Gas concrete slab carry out it is longitudinally cutting, existing slitter to autoclaved lightweight sand aerated concrete plate carry out it is longitudinally cutting when,
When needing to cut the autoclaved lightweight sand aerated concrete plate of different-thickness, then needs replacing different blade fixing seats and cut
Knife come meet different-thickness autoclaved lightweight sand aerated concrete plate it is longitudinally cutting, this kind of mode of operation replacement trouble and waste
Time, so that the longitudinally cutting low efficiency of autoclaved lightweight sand aerated concrete plate.

(3) beneficial effect
The utility model provides a kind of autoclaved lightweight sand aerated concrete plate slitter.Have it is following the utility model has the advantages that
(1), the utility model autoclaved lightweight sand aerated concrete plate slitter, by autoclaved lightweight sand aerated concrete plate
It is placed on the upper surface of station, the rotation of the first driving motor task driven shaft, shaft band moving knife during rotation
Piece fixing seat and cutter synchronous rotary so that autoclaved lightweight sand aerated concrete plate on station convey during, cutter
Can be longitudinally cutting to the progress of autoclaved lightweight sand aerated concrete plate, cut surface is smooth, can once mix autoclaved lightweight sand aerating
Concrete board is cut into a plurality of, cutting efficiency height.
(2), the utility model autoclaved lightweight sand aerated concrete plate slitter, when the steam pressure for needing to cut different-thickness
When lightweight sand aerated concrete plate, the second driving motor task driven gear rotation, since wheel and rack engages, so that gear
Move up and down under the guiding role of directive slide track during rotation with carry-over bar, rack gear move up and down so that connecting plate,
Shaft, blade fixing seat are synchronous with cutter to move up and down, and spacing of the cutter between station is adjustable at this time, so that cutter can
Longitudinally cutting, wide adaptation range is carried out to the autoclaved lightweight sand aerated concrete plate of different-thickness.
